Output 6503243773603b7bf1ae33df5f31bced96e382c571575d29e9a1e5cc3ef83774:0

value
74000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a877bc67c98a984d48a0d1486d41868b48cadad7 OP_EQUAL
address
3H3ntAuFYtsbXVZEauwt49BeawXzBwtFmp
transaction
6503243773603b7bf1ae33df5f31bced96e382c571575d29e9a1e5cc3ef83774
spent
true